Size: a a a

jQuery — русскоговорящее общество

2021 January 03

G

Gregory in jQuery — русскоговорящее общество
Подскажите, плиз, как остановить или прервать функцию с событием mousemove?
источник

cN

cobrascript Niko in jQuery — русскоговорящее общество
Gregory
Подскажите, плиз, как остановить или прервать функцию с событием mousemove?
Отключить событие с помощью .off("event", ...)
источник

G

Gregory in jQuery — русскоговорящее общество
Ребят, подскажите, плиз, как по клику остановить действие события "mousemove" на чистом ЖС?

У меня есть функция с событием "mousemove". Данная функция запускается, а потом по клику я хочу ее действие приостановить. Как возможно это возможно сделать?
источник

J

Johnny in jQuery — русскоговорящее общество
Gregory
Ребят, подскажите, плиз, как по клику остановить действие события "mousemove" на чистом ЖС?

У меня есть функция с событием "mousemove". Данная функция запускается, а потом по клику я хочу ее действие приостановить. Как возможно это возможно сделать?
В смысле "приостановить"? Покажите код в песочнице
источник

G

Gregory in jQuery — русскоговорящее общество
Johnny
В смысле "приостановить"? Покажите код в песочнице
Для примерного понимания  накидал в песочину кривой пример необходимого.
КЛикаем на первый квадрат и он начинает следовать за мышью. Когда отрываем палец от кнопки, то квадрат должен перестать двигаться за мышью

https://codepen.io/Gregorygf/pen/OJRvOmy?editors=1010
источник

J

Johnny in jQuery — русскоговорящее общество
Gregory
Для примерного понимания  накидал в песочину кривой пример необходимого.
КЛикаем на первый квадрат и он начинает следовать за мышью. Когда отрываем палец от кнопки, то квадрат должен перестать двигаться за мышью

https://codepen.io/Gregorygf/pen/OJRvOmy?editors=1010
.removeEventListener()
источник

zN

zVlad Nesquik in jQuery — русскоговорящее общество
Привет!
А сейчас актуально указывать
<script language="javascript1.1" type="text/javascript">
или
<script language="javascript1.2" type="text/javascript">
?
Или сейчас можно просто написать вот так
<script language="javascript" type="text/javascript">
и все?
источник

G

Gregory in jQuery — русскоговорящее общество
Johnny
.removeEventListener()
можешь помочь? чет не понимаю, как .removeEventListener() может в моем случае помочь
источник

J

Johnny in jQuery — русскоговорящее общество
zVlad Nesquik
Привет!
А сейчас актуально указывать
<script language="javascript1.1" type="text/javascript">
или
<script language="javascript1.2" type="text/javascript">
?
Или сейчас можно просто написать вот так
<script language="javascript" type="text/javascript">
и все?
Вроде вообще необязательно
источник

J

Johnny in jQuery — русскоговорящее общество
Gregory
можешь помочь? чет не понимаю, как .removeEventListener() может в моем случае помочь
Ну вы вначале добавляете обработчик события, чтобы обработчик перестал обрабатывать событие, есть метод для удаления обработчика
источник

J

Johnny in jQuery — русскоговорящее общество
Погуглите, там всё straight forward
источник

G

Gregory in jQuery — русскоговорящее общество
Johnny
Ну вы вначале добавляете обработчик события, чтобы обработчик перестал обрабатывать событие, есть метод для удаления обработчика
Все, кажется понял.
Спасибо
источник

J

Johnny in jQuery — русскоговорящее общество
Johnny
Вроде вообще необязательно
Вернее даже, этот атрибут language давно устарел и не должен использоваться
источник

G

Gregory in jQuery — русскоговорящее общество
Johnny
Ну вы вначале добавляете обработчик события, чтобы обработчик перестал обрабатывать событие, есть метод для удаления обработчика
не, я в обще не понял, как в моем случае это может помочь.
источник
2021 January 04

A

Alex in jQuery — русскоговорящее общество
Gregory
не, я в обще не понял, как в моем случае это может помочь.
а что непонятного? добавляешь событие, удаляешь событие, куда проще-то?
источник

G

Gregory in jQuery — русскоговорящее общество
Alex
а что непонятного? добавляешь событие, удаляешь событие, куда проще-то?
Удаление события тут не помощник
источник

A

Alex in jQuery — русскоговорящее общество
Gregory
Удаление события тут не помощник
Когда отрываем палец от кнопки, то квадрат должен перестать двигаться за мышью
это и есть удаление события
источник

A

Alex in jQuery — русскоговорящее общество
делается для того, чтобы после того, как кнопка мыши не нажата, больше не следим за ней
источник

G

Gregory in jQuery — русскоговорящее общество
Alex
Когда отрываем палец от кнопки, то квадрат должен перестать двигаться за мышью
это и есть удаление события
Ну, тогда логичнее mouseup использовать
источник

A

Alex in jQuery — русскоговорящее общество
Gregory
Ну, тогда логичнее mouseup использовать
ну да, там и удалять событие mousemove
источник